Himalaya Diarex is an Ayurvedic product. It is helpful for acute & chronic diarrhoeas of various aetiologies

Each Tablet Contains: 

Extracts: 

Kutaja (Holarrhena antidysenterica) Bk. - 245 mg

Guduchi (Tinospora cordifolia) St. - 16 mg

Powders: 

Bilva (Aegle marmelos) Fr. - 245 mg

Dadima (Punica granatum) Fr.R. - 82 mg 

Shankh Bhasma - 61 mg

Musta (Cyperus rotundus) Tr. - 51 mg

Dosage Information - 

Children 1/2 to 1 tablet twice daily & adults 1 to 2 tablets twice daily, or as directed by your doctor.

Storage Information - Store in a dry place, away from direct heat & sunlight. Do not refrigerate.

Description- Himalaya Diarex 30 Tablets

Diarex contains a host of natural ingredients like coneru and bael that have antimicrobial and astringent properties. It eliminates common microorganisms responsible for acute and chronic infectious diarrhea and amoebiasis. As an antioxidant, Diarex restores GI health. Diarex’s anti-inflammatory and demulcent properties facilitate healing of the intestinal mucosa, and its antispasmodic action alleviates abdominal colic associated with bowel infection. It is often used as an adjuvant to the treatment of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S). Diarex does not produce any harmful side effects. To determine your dose, consult a physician.
